Position Summary

The Bartender is responsible for preparing, serving, and maintaining high-quality beverage service at catered events. This role requires exceptional customer service skills, strong product knowledge, and adherence to all alcohol service laws and company standards. The Bartender ensures that guests enjoy a professional, efficient, and safe beverage experience while maintaining a clean and organized bar area.

This role pays an hourly rate of $10.00 to $15.00 and is tip eligible

Responsibilities
  • Set up and break down bar service areas for catered events, including stocking beverages, glassware, garnishes, and necessary equipment.
  • Greet guests warmly, take drink orders, and prepare alcoholic and non-alcoholic beverages to company and event specifications.
  • Monitor guest consumption and practice responsible alcohol service in compliance with state and local regulations.
  • Maintain cleanliness and sanitation of the bar area, tools, and service equipment in accordance with food safety and hygiene guidelines.
  • Handle credit card transactions and reconcile sales at the end of each event when required.
  • Collaborate with catering team members to ensure smooth service flow and timely guest satisfaction.
  • Respond promptly to guest needs, questions, or concerns in a friendly and professional manner.
  • Follow company policies regarding responsible service, safety, and operational procedures.
Qualifications
  • Minimum of 12 years bartending experience, preferably in a catering, banquet, or high-volume event setting.
  • Knowledge of drink recipes, mixology techniques, and bar equipment operation.
  • Current alcohol service certification (e.g., TIPS, ServSafe Alcohol) preferred as well as Food Handlers.
  • Strong interpersonal skills and ability to work effectively in a team environment.
  • Ability to stand for extended periods, lift up to 25 lbs.
  • Available to work a flexible schedule, including nights, weekends, and holidays.
